Claudia Ketchum Obituary

Claudia’s life was a living example of her favorite bible verse, Trust in the Lord and do what is good; dwell in the land and live securely. Take delight in the Lord, and he will give you your heart desires – Psalm 37:3-4.

It is with great sadness that the family of Claudia Jane Ketchum, beloved wife, sister, mother, stepmother, cousin, and friend, announce her passing on Monday, January 6, 2025, at 65.

Claudia will be lovingly remembered by her devoted husband Rick, her sister Lisa (Harry) Suszko, brother Chris Jahncke, daughter Amanda (Zach) Spargo, and stepson Drew (Jessy) Ketchum. She was proud to be a grandma to her step-grandchildren Eli, Niam, Ruthie Ketchum; Austin, and Dominic Spargo. Also remembering her are dear cousins Garry (Denise) and Craig (Roseann Walker) Teague; step-siblings Robert Cummings, John (Jill) Cummings, Peggy (Gerry) Kramer, and Mary Beth (Steve) Bender.

Claudia thrived at being organized and creative – decorating their homes and landscapes beautifully and designing homemade cards and heartfelt fun gifts for her family. Her creativity, decorating, and organization talents were shared cheerfully with others as well (especially with her sister Lisa).

Claudia’s greatest gifts were her faith and her love of family. She and the love of her life Rick enjoyed each other’s company whether it be on an adventurous vacation, dining at restaurants (or enjoying Rick’s cooking), exploring/participating in new activities, floating around the lazy river or just enjoying a relaxing evening at home. She also adored her family and cherished every moment with them, providing them with a strong foundation of love and support. Claudia was always behind the camera taking pictures to document the moments that were special to her, capturing smiles and laughter forever in her heart.  Her motto was, “You have to take a lot of pictures just to get one good one.”

Thank you all for your care, kindness, and prayers. Claudia exemplified a life full of the fruits of the spirit; Love, Joy, Peace, Patience, Kindness, Goodness, Faithfulness, Gentleness, and Self-control. To know her was to love her and be loved by her. 

Peace I leave with you; my peace I give you. I do not give to you as the world gives. Do not let your hearts be troubled and do not be afraid. John 14:27. Dance freely with the Angels' darling Claudia.

Mrs. Ketchum is entrusted to Kelvin Lewis, the funeral director, and the Lewis Crematory & Funeral Home Staff of Myrtle Beach, SC.
